Digital Certificates and Web Services with Oracle APEX

Hi people,
I am working to implement Web Service communication using Oracle Apex. I need to create an application that calls an external public Web Service in Apex. So far, so good, and i am able to work with a public WS without any problems.
However, this particular WS I'm calling has two peculiarities:
1) It is SSL-Secured (HTTPS). This means i have to communicate using SSL and Public/Private Certificates.
2) The message i pass (payload) must be digitally signed using XMLDsig Standard (www.w3.org/TR/xmldsig-core/)
The first requirement i am still testing, but it will probably work if i import the public and private keys using Oracle Wallet and point to this Wallet, just as PayPal sample in OTN samples does, don't you think? Should i have any problems with this?
The second one is more complicated, all APIs i have seen for XML Digital Signing are Java-based or .NET-based, i have found nothing based in PL/SQL packages or such. Can you point me some other options to sign this XML?
Please bear in mind that, since the WS has more than one method, i am using plain old UTL_HTTP to call it (just like the PayPal sample in OTN). PayPal requests that all communication be SSL-enabled, but has no mention whatsoever for Digital Signatures.
Can anybody help me out with this? any help is highly appreciated.
Regards
Thiago

Thiago:
You are correct in that there should be no problem interacting with a Web service that has an HTTPS endpoint as long as you create a wallet and specify it when you make your UTL_HTTP calls, like the PayPal example.
I am not aware of a PL/SQL utility to create a XMLDsig Standard message, but if you find some Java source out there that does it, you may be able to follow a technique I used for a similar use case:
http://jastraub.blogspot.com/2009/07/hmacsha256-in-plsql.html
Regards,
Jason

    I had this error again so I thought I would post my solution:
    The issue is SAP needs to know the certificates being used by the web site being called.  These certificates are automatically installed in your browser but need to be manually installed in SAP.  This is what I did:
    How to find/install new certificates
    Make sure you run Internet Explorer as an Administrator so you can export the certificates
    Go to the web site that SAP is trying to call in Internet Explorer
    Double click on the lock in the address bar
    View certificates
    Find the certificates that are being used
    Tools --> Internet Options --> Content --> Certificates
    Click on the “Trusted Root Certification Authorities” tab
    Find the certificate identified in step iii
    Export as a CER certificate
    Click on the “Intermediate Certification Authorities” tab
    Find the certificate identified in step iii
    Export as a CER certificate
    Go to STRUST in SAP
    Import the Certificates in the “Anonymous” or “Standard” SSL client
    Save
    RESTART the ICM via t-code SMICM  <-- Critical!!!
    Test

    SunJSSE implement SSL server CertificateRequest in a strict mode, if client failed to find a proper certificate corresponding the server request, it does not guess what's the proper certificate and send to the server. In your case, because there is no intermediate certificate in the client context, so there is no way to make the decision which certificate would be acceptable by server, so client does not send any cert to server. That's why you got a handshaking error.
    I guess your client key store does not contains a full certificate path from the client end-entity certificate to the root CA. Please import the full certificate path into the key store.
    BTW, these approaches should work, but I found no reason why one does not adopt #1:
    1. import the full certification path of client certificate into client key store.
    2. as a workaround, configure the server to send a list including the intermediate certificates;
    3. as a workaround, you will have to customize the client KeyManager if you don't want to or are not able to configure the server to send a list including the intermediate certificates.
